The Real Problems With Manual Check Workflows

Paper-based payments create more work than most teams expect. Here are the pain points that show up month after month.

Printer dependence: A single jammed tray can stall an entire payment run. Because everything waits on hardware, one mechanical hiccup delays your vendors.

Stamp and post office runs: Someone still drives envelopes to the mailbox. So a finance manager loses productive hours to errands that add no value.

No visibility after sending: Once a paper check leaves the building, it disappears into the mail. Therefore you cannot tell a vendor whether their payment is on the way.

Rising fraud exposure: Checks remain the most-targeted payment type. In fact, 63% of organizations faced check fraud in 2024, according to the AFP Payments Fraud and Control Survey.

Messy reconciliation: Handwritten registers and scattered receipts slow the monthly close. As a result, your books take longer to balance and errors creep in.

Rigid payment options: Some vendors want paper, others want electronic. However, manual systems rarely support both without extra tools.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are digital checks online?

Digital checks online are payments you create, send, and track through a web platform instead of by hand. You can print them, mail them, or deliver them electronically. The full record stays in one dashboard. This gives you visibility that paper alone cannot match.

Can I still print checks online if a vendor wants paper?

Yes. You can print checks online on plain white paper using a standard printer. There is no need for expensive pre-printed stock. The platform formats the check with the correct MICR details automatically.

How does it work when I mail a check online?

When you mail a check online, the platform prints, inserts, and posts the check for you. You enter the details and approve the payment. Then the mailing happens without a trip to the post office. Delivery timing depends on the postal option you choose.

Are digital checks safe from fraud?

Digital tools include controls such as Positive Pay and detailed audit trails. These features are designed to help reduce certain fraud risks. However, no payment system eliminates fraud risk entirely. You remain responsible for monitoring your account and following your financial institution’s security practices.
